Wat Nam Hoo, Maehongson
 

Located outside of Pai town on the same route to Mae Paeng waterfall, Wat Nam Hoo is known in name of its sacred ‘Pra Singha’-style Buddha image, called "Un Mueang".  The buddha image is enshired inside the hall but having water permeating from the head part.  It is sacred by the local people.

Located at Moo 5, Tambol Wiang Tai, 3 kms off Pai Town. Pra Un Mueang Buddha image is enshirned in this vihara.

Princess Prasuphankanya, elder sister of the great King Naraesuan, in Ayutthaya time.

It is said that her bones have been kept in the pagoda behind the vihara.
